Hayden Panettiere has focused on the actual changes she encountered after the passing of her more youthful sibling Jansen.
The Shout 6 entertainer lost her sibling in February 2023 when he was 28 years of age. In a proclamation at the time their family uncovered his reason for death, stating, "However it offers little comfort, the Clinical Analyst revealed Jansen's unexpected passing was because of cardiomegaly (expanded heart), combined with aortic valve entanglements."
The entertainer as of late addressed Individuals for their September main story, making sense of that she put on weight while adapting to the deficiency of her sibling.
"I just swelled out," she told the power source, taking note of that she acquired 40 pounds in a brief timeframe. "It didn't make any difference what I did, what I ate. I know pressure and cortisol going through your body can do that. Presently I think my body was safeguarding itself, protecting itself from the world."
The Legends alum added that the weight gain caused her to have a shaky outlook on going out in the event that she was shot.
"I needed to see horrendous paparazzi pictures of myself emerging from Jansen's memorial service, which occurred in an extremely confidential spot, and it was stunning," the entertainer said. "I didn't perceive myself. My agoraphobia emerged, which is something I've battled with before."
Agoraphobia is a sort of nervousness problem that outcomes in the trepidation or general evasion of circumstances that can cause an individual to feel caught, defenseless, or humiliated, as per the Mayo Center. "For instance, you might fear utilizing public transportation, being in open or encased spaces, remaining in line, or being in a group," the center states.
Panettiere made sense of that her agoraphobia originated from being a kid entertainer and continually being on camera since early on. "Having experienced childhood in this industry, you're unnerved in the event that you don't look respectable when you leave," she said.
